I tried Herbalife before, using their 5 meds combination. It depends on how much weight you want to lose. If you want to lose 5-10 lbs, then you can use the 3 meds combination, and so forth. I want to lose a lot, so I used the 5 meds combi.

The process is skipping meals and you only need to eat one heavy meal. You will then drink a Hi-protein Shake as a replacement for the skipped meals. The other meds are vitamins, cellulite remover, cleansing tablets, green tea.

I lost weight when I was on this for 1-2 months, but I can't stand skipping meals. When I stopped taking the shakes and started eating again, I gained all the weight I lost.

I really can't say if it's effective in the log run since most of the people can't skip meals. Their meds combination are expensive too.
